Inspirational Teamwork in Palliative Care – Home Instead

Home Instead Sunshine Coast & Gympie are the winners of the 2021 Palliative Care in Queensland Inspirational Teamwork in Palliative Care Award.

Home Instead has earned an exceptional reputation within the community as a specialised care provider committed to tailoring support and developing sustainable strategies to enhance the lives of older Australians.

Established in 2011, Home Instead has become the trusted choice for personal support services, being recognised experts in advanced Dementia conditions and palliative care.

In association with their registered non-for-profit charity “The Home Instead Foundation”, the organisation’s core focus is helping those isolated and disadvantaged maintain their independence; to allow them to live in their own homes long-term and optimise their quality of life.

They do this by being actively involved in many community engagement initiatives; designing innovative programs that lead to better diagnosis, treatment, prevention, awareness and research.
